Tiffin has two methods of mounting the front TVs that I'm aware of. The first is if a view to the bottom of the TV from below is available, look up underneath and there will be four to five screws in the mounting plate. Be sure to have someone else support the TV as you remove the screws as it can drop. If the cabinet around the TV is solid, the second way is inside the cabinets on each side of the TV there are removable thin plywood panels next to the TV. Remove these cover panels and there will be a couple of screws holding the TV mount in place.
